IBM computer struggles in Cambridge debate on the dangers of AI
AI has the potential to power driverless cars and smart cities. But critics say the technology could perpetuate bias, put people out of work and even threaten human existence. About 500 university students attended Thursday's debate, hinting at just how controversial the technology is. The IBM machine, which was defeated by a human in a one-on-one debate nine months ago, delivered each team's 4-minute opening speech using submissions sourced ahead of time from over 1,000 people. The rebuttals by each side were done by the human debaters, who also delivered the closing arguments.
